Strain gauge CRLC 20 t (Special developments)
With the CRLC strain gauge from Esit, it is easy to measure tensile forces. Protective plates and washers protect the sensor from overloads. The degree of protection IP66 makes the steel body of the sensor practically invulnerable, it is covered with a special anti-corrosion paint and has full moisture and dust protection.
Cranes and mechanisms similar to them are the main field of use of CRLC strain gauges, which are used wherever it is necessary to measure the load or control the overloading of cables.
| Rated load (Emax) | kg | 20000 |
| Accuracy class (OIML R 60) | ||
| Discreteness by class ( n LC ) | ||
| Minimum weighing interval (V min ) | ||
| A common mistake | % Emax | ≤ ± 0.5 |
| Error of return to zero (DR) | % Emax | |
| Minimum load | % Emax | 0 |
| Maximum overload | % Emax | 150 |
| Permissible horizontal overload | % Emax | |
| Destructive overload | % Emax | 300 |
| Deformation (at Emax) | mm | |
| Maximum excitation voltage (Umax) | IN | 10 |
| RCP (Cn) | mV / V | 1 |
| Zero balance | % Cn | ≤ ± 2.0 |
| Input impedance | Ω | 380 |
| Output resistance | Ω | 350 |
| Insulation resistance | MΩ | ≥500 |
| Compensated operating range | ° С | -10 … + 40 |
| Operating temperature range | ° С | -40 … + 80 |
| Sensor material | Steel | |
| Protection class (according to EN60529 classification) | IP66 | |
| Cable length | m | 5 |
| Cable diameter | mm | 5 |
| Mass | kg | 9.7 |
| Package weight and dimensions | cm / kg | 32x34x15 / 10.2 |
